Hi Community & AlDente Team,
When I do a right click on the AlDente menu item in the bar where the clock is, it then moves/sets the percentage regulator up to 100%.
Is this on purpose or did I discover a bug? :-)
Greetings and keep up the good work!
AlDente Pro 1.08
macOS Monterey 12.0.1

Hi @the-please-is-mine,
This is actually a feature called "Shortcuts". :)
A right-click on the AlDente icon alternates between setting the charge limit to 100% and pausing at the current SoC.
